Output 25ca8dce31208191741523ff3d85d9769039bc31365fbbefebf1b80d4ece69eb:1

value
93081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52d4c044c0c16cc6b21d80abcf8916ba2857e4bd OP_EQUAL
address
39EzCUZ99mXUjb5NxToLqyJD8SkdMejL1M
transaction
25ca8dce31208191741523ff3d85d9769039bc31365fbbefebf1b80d4ece69eb
confirmations
78206
spent
true